Transaction 63859f390acc0c41638449fd31f276d205fee1ae94e3705c54a0099e11c14eb9

2 Input
2 Outputs
  • 63859f390acc0c41638449fd31f276d205fee1ae94e3705c54a0099e11c14eb9:0
  • value  315175
    address  1ACRqmM6H6VBKyC68W2puSgUWEDZUqE6EG
  • 63859f390acc0c41638449fd31f276d205fee1ae94e3705c54a0099e11c14eb9:1
  • value  7997505
    address  13BjjoemwKVcjSAvkXAGTKGw4jgiGnhWs4